Abstract

This patent discloses a kind of printing devices, including shell, paper feed unit and print unit, print unit includes print head and print cartridge, the print cartridge includes box body, filter plate and ink tube, sliding slot is offered on the inboard wall of cartridge, the filter plate is slidably connected in sliding slot, the minitype cylinder for driving filter plate to slide in sliding slot is fixed on the filter plate, several spine protrusions are equipped on the inside of the upper surface of the box body, at least one electromagnet is fixed on the box body lower inside wall, the box body is provided at least one hollow metal ball, the top of sliding slot is equipped with the contact-making switch being electrically connected with electromagnet.This programme solves the problems, such as that ink stick blocking filter screen and ink stick cannot be recycled and be resulted in waste of resources.

Background technique
Ink printer is that liquid ink is become fine particles through nozzle to be sprayed onto printing paper, in ink printer, is led to It is often used and is detachably mounted to ink printer and the print cartridge connecting with print head provides ink for print head.Existing print cartridge Including cartridge body, cartridge body is equipped with ink outlet mouth.The jack that ink outlet mouth is aligned on ink jet printing device by cartridge body is held, And be inserted into jack, print cartridge will be to print head for ink.
Ink stick in ink mostly containing condensation, be easy to cause the blocking of print cartridge.Chinese notification number is CN207549748U Patent document disclose a kind of recyclable economizing type print cartridge, including box body, the front end side of box body is connected with black chamber, black chamber Front end is hinged with inky cap, and the top for stating black chamber is provided with tongue rubber and leads mouth, and closely coupled there is sea in the lower end that tongue rubber leads mouth Continuous layer, the lower end of spongy layer is closely coupled metal filter screen, and floating grain is provided in the middle part of black chamber.Metal filter screen and spongy layer Double filtration is carried out to institute's ink.
In above scheme, ink stick is deposited in spongy layer and metal filtration is online, be easy to cause spongy layer and metal filter screen Blocking.Ink stick is to be condensed in ink by effective color component, and ink stick is removed, effective color in one side ink at Divide concentration that will reduce, influence print quality, on the other hand abandoning ink stick will also result in the waste of resource.
Summary of the invention
The invention is intended to provide a kind of printing device, it cannot recycle and make to solve ink stick blocking filter screen and ink stick The problem of at the wasting of resources.
In order to achieve the above object, base case of the invention is as follows:
A kind of printing device, including shell, paper feed unit and print unit, the paper feed unit and print unit are fixed On the shell, the paper feed unit end is located at immediately below print unit, and print unit includes the print head and print cartridge of connection, institute Stating print cartridge includes box body, filter plate and ink tube, and sliding slot is offered on the inboard wall of cartridge, and the filter plate is slidably connected at cunning In slot, the minitype cylinder for driving filter plate to slide in sliding slot, the upper surface of the box body are fixed on the filter plate Inside is equipped with several spine protrusions, is fixed at least one electromagnet on the box body lower inside wall, the box body is provided with At least one hollow metal ball, the top of sliding slot are equipped with the contact-making switch being electrically connected with electromagnet.
The principle of base case:Print cartridge is fixed on shell, and print cartridge is connected to print head.Into the ink of print cartridge By the filtering of filter plate, ink passes through filter plate and flows to print cartridge bottom, and the ink stick being condensed into blocks stays on filter plate.Start micro- Type cylinder, minitype cylinder drive filter plate along sliding slot upward sliding, and filter screen slides into sliding slot top and contacts with print cartridge top surface, Ink stick is crushed by the spine protrusion of print cartridge top surface, and the broken small clast of ink stick is dropped down onto ink by filter plate.
Hollow metal sphere will swim in ink level in the case where not by external force, when filter plate slides into sliding slot top When, filter plate contacts that contact-making switch, subsequent electromagnet are powered, and electromagnet, which is powered, generates magnetic force, under the action of electromagnet magnetic force, Metal ball is moved to the direction of electromagnet, to complete the stirring to ink.
The advantages of base case:(1) the spine male cooperation filter plate for utilizing box body top surface, by the ink stick pressure on filter plate Broken, the ink stick clast after crushing is entered in ink and is dissolved in the ink, be ensure that the concentration of ink script, is avoided simultaneously The waste of the effective color component of ink.
(2) filter plate stays in volume biggish ink stick on filter plate, after avoiding ink stick from entering in ink with ink into The case where entering print head blocking print head, ensure that the normal work of printing device.
(3) electromagnet of hollow metal sphere and intermittently power-on is utilized, metal ball moves back and forth between the water surface and electromagnet, To realize stirring to ink, on the one hand stirring accelerates the dissolution of ink stick clast, on the other hand avoid ink occur precipitating and The situation for causing drop mass bad occurs.
Further, the top surface of the filter plate also is provided with several spine protrusions.Spine protrusion on the inside of cassette upper end face with The spine male cooperation for filtering plate top surface, preferably grinds effect to reach, so that ink stick clast is more tiny, convenient for being dissolved in In ink.
Further, the upper surface of the box body is equipped with ink entrance, is removably connected at ink entrance for blocking ink entrance End cap.When the ink in print cartridge be consumed to ink it is less when, end cap can be opened, ink is added into box body by ink entrance Water realizes recycling for print cartridge.
Further, there are two the electromagnet and metal ball are all provided with.Two metal balls are random to be contacted with any electromagnet, So that the motion profile of metal ball is random, chaotic, mixing effect is more preferable.
Further, heater strip is equipped in the box body.Heater strip heats the ink in print cartridge, on the one hand can add The dissolution of fast ink stick clast, on the other hand can be to avoid ink lumps.

Specific embodiment
It is further described below by specific embodiment:
Appended drawing reference in Figure of description includes:Shell 1, paper feed unit 2, print unit 3, print head 4, print cartridge 5, box Body 6, filter plate 7, ink tube 8, ink entrance 9, end cap 10, sliding slot 11, minitype cylinder 12, spine protrusion 13, electromagnet 14, metal Ball 15, contact-making switch 16.
Embodiment
Substantially as shown in Figure 1:A kind of printing device, including shell 1, paper feed unit 2 and print unit 3,2 He of paper feed unit Print unit 3 is each attached on shell 1, and 2 end of paper feed unit is located at immediately below print unit 3, and print unit 3 includes connection Print head 4 and print cartridge 5, as shown in connection with fig. 2, print cartridge 5 include box body 6, filter plate 7 and ink tube 8, and the upper surface of box body 6 opens up There is ink entrance 9, the end cap 10 for blocking ink entrance 9 is connected at ink entrance 9.Sliding slot 11 is offered on 6 inner wall of box body, is filtered Plate 7 is slidably connected in sliding slot 11, is bolted on filter plate 7 for driving filter plate 7 to slide in sliding slot 11 The upper surface inside of minitype cylinder 12, box body 6 is equipped with several spine protrusions 13, and it is convex that the top surface of filter plate 7 also is provided with several spines Play 13.The upper surface of box body 6, the top surface of filter plate 7 and spine protrusion 13 are integrally formed.Pass through spiral shell on 6 lower inside wall of box body Bolt is fixed, and there are two electromagnet 14, and box body 6 is built-in, and there are two hollow metal balls 15, and the top of sliding slot 11 has been bolted The contact-making switch 16 being electrically connected with electromagnet 14.
Specific implementation process is as follows:Print cartridge 5 is fixed on shell, and print cartridge 5 is connected to print head 4.Into print cartridge 5 Ink pass through filter plate 7 filtering, ink pass through filter plate 7 flow to 5 bottom of print cartridge, the ink stick being condensed into blocks stays in filter plate On 7.Start minitype cylinder 12, minitype cylinder 12 drives filter plate 7 along 11 upward sliding of sliding slot, and filter screen slides into sliding slot 11 Top is contacted with 5 top surface of print cartridge, and ink stick is crushed by the spine protrusion 13 of 7 top surface of 5 top surface of print cartridge and filter plate, broken ink stick Small clast is dropped down onto ink by filter plate 7.
Hollow metal sphere 15 will swim in ink level in the case where not by external force, when filter plate 7 slides into sliding slot 11 When top, filter plate 7 contacts that contact-making switch 16, subsequent electromagnet 14 are powered, and electromagnet 14, which is powered, generates magnetic force, in electromagnet 14 Under the action of magnetic force, two metal balls 15 are random to be moved to any electromagnet 14 and contacts with electromagnet 14, thus completion pair The stirring of ink.
In addition, being equipped with heater strip (not shown) in box body 6.Heater strip heats the ink in print cartridge 5, a side Face can accelerate the dissolution of ink stick clast, on the other hand can be to avoid ink lumps.
